Common questions

Is magnetic eyelashes profitable to sell on Amazon United States?
The niche generates $2.3M/yr across 50 tracked products. 19 of 40 products launched in the last 360 days are still selling. 90-day search growth is +16.0%. Flapen's verdict: Launch it (69/100).
How competitive is the magnetic eyelashes niche?
24 brands and 60 sellers compete. The top 5 products take 34% of clicks and top 5 brands hold 59% of demand.
What do buyers complain about in magnetic eyelashes?
Top complaints mined from reviews: Ease Of Use, Eyelash Quality, Functionality-Overall. The return rate is 2.6%.
When does demand for magnetic eyelashes peak?
Demand peaks in Jul; the busiest month runs 1.6× the quietest.
What does it cost to enter the magnetic eyelashes niche?
Listings span $6.31–$47.64; the average listing price is $13.68 (sweet spot $15–$100). The average incumbent carries 5,235 reviews — the moat a new listing must climb.
